Essential_guidance_exploring_winspirit_for_seamless_software_deployment_and_adva

Essential guidance exploring winspirit for seamless software deployment and advanced automation solutions

In the realm of software deployment and automation, efficiency and reliability are paramount. Organizations constantly seek tools that streamline their processes, reduce errors, and accelerate time to market. Among the solutions available, winspirit emerges as a compelling option, offering a robust set of features designed to tackle complex automation challenges. This tool isn’t simply about automating repetitive tasks; it’s about crafting a cohesive, adaptable system that anticipates needs and responds proactively to evolving demands.

The modern IT landscape is characterized by rapid change and increasing complexity. Traditional methods of software management often fall short, leading to bottlenecks, inconsistencies, and ultimately, diminished productivity. Winspirit aims to bridge this gap by providing a centralized platform for managing configurations, executing scripts, and monitoring system health. Its adaptability allows integration with a wide array of existing systems, avoiding the costly and disruptive process of wholesale infrastructure overhaul. The core principle driving its design centers on simplification, making powerful automation accessible to a broader range of users, not just seasoned scripting experts.

Understanding the Core Functionalities of Winspirit

At its heart, winspirit is a powerful automation engine capable of executing a diverse range of tasks. From simple file transfers and system updates to complex application deployments and database manipulations, the platform provides the tools to orchestrate even the most intricate workflows. Central to this capability is its scripting language, which is designed to be both intuitive and expressive. Users can leverage pre-built commands and functions or create custom scripts tailored to their specific requirements. The visual interface further enhances usability, allowing users to design and monitor automation sequences without needing to delve into complex code. This is a significant advantage for teams with varying levels of technical expertise.

Scripting and Automation Sequences

The scripting capabilities of winspirit are robust, supporting variables, conditional statements, loops, and error handling. This allows for the creation of dynamic and resilient automation sequences that can adapt to changing conditions. Furthermore, the platform supports the execution of scripts remotely, enabling centralized management of distributed systems. Debugging tools are also integrated, simplifying the process of identifying and resolving issues within automation workflows. Effective scripting is critical for maximizing the benefits of any automation tool, and winspirit offers a comprehensive environment for script development and maintenance. Properly crafted scripts ensure reliable and predictable automation, minimizing the risk of human error and maximizing efficiency.

Feature Description
Remote Execution Scripts can be executed on remote systems without manual intervention.
Error Handling Built-in mechanisms for detecting and handling errors during script execution.
Variable Support Allows for the use of variables to store and manipulate data within scripts.
Conditional Logic Enables scripts to execute different branches of code based on specified conditions.

The table above illustrates some of the key features that empower effective scripting within the winspirit environment. Utilizing these features allows for the creation of highly tailored automation solutions.

Deployment and Configuration Management

One of the primary strengths of winspirit lies in its ability to streamline software deployment and configuration management. Manually deploying applications across numerous systems can be a time-consuming and error-prone process. Winspirit automates this process, ensuring consistency and reducing the risk of misconfigurations. The platform allows users to define deployment packages containing all the necessary files, scripts, and configurations. These packages can then be deployed to target systems with a single click. This capability is particularly valuable for organizations that manage large-scale deployments or frequently release new software versions. Moreover, winspirit’s version control features enable easy rollback to previous configurations in case of issues.

Centralized Configuration Control

Maintaining consistent configurations across multiple systems is crucial for stability and security. Winspirit provides a centralized repository for storing and managing configuration files. Changes to these files can be propagated to target systems automatically, ensuring that all systems remain in sync. This eliminates the need for manual configuration updates, reducing the risk of inconsistencies and vulnerabilities. The platform also supports configuration auditing, allowing administrators to track changes and identify potential issues. This centralized control is a significant improvement over traditional methods, which often rely on manual processes and decentralized configuration management.

  • Automated software installations and updates.
  • Centralized configuration file management.
  • Version control for configuration changes.
  • Remote configuration management capabilities.
  • Support for diverse operating systems and application platforms.

The listed benefits highlight the versatility of winspirit in managing complex configurations. The ability to manage configurations remotely and consistently is a major advantage.

System Monitoring and Alerting

Beyond deployment and configuration management, winspirit offers robust system monitoring and alerting capabilities. The platform can monitor key system metrics, such as CPU usage, memory consumption, disk space, and network traffic. When these metrics exceed predefined thresholds, alerts can be triggered, notifying administrators of potential issues. This proactive approach allows administrators to address problems before they escalate, minimizing downtime and ensuring system stability. The monitoring features aren't limited to hardware resources; they also extend to application health and performance, providing a comprehensive view of the entire system landscape. Detailed logs and reporting tools further aid in troubleshooting and performance analysis.

Real-Time Monitoring and Reporting

Real-time monitoring provides immediate insights into system health and performance. Winspirit’s dashboard displays key metrics in a clear and concise manner, allowing administrators to quickly identify potential issues. Customizable reports can be generated to track trends and analyze historical data. These reports can be used to identify performance bottlenecks, optimize resource allocation, and plan for future capacity needs. The platform also integrates with popular notification systems, allowing administrators to receive alerts via email, SMS, or other channels. This ensures that they are promptly informed of any critical issues requiring immediate attention. Effective monitoring and reporting are essential for maintaining a stable and efficient IT infrastructure.

  1. Define monitoring thresholds for critical system metrics.
  2. Configure alerts to be triggered when thresholds are exceeded.
  3. Generate customizable reports to track trends and analyze data.
  4. Integrate with notification systems for prompt alerts.
  5. Utilize detailed logs for troubleshooting and performance analysis.

Following these steps will help maximize the value of the monitoring functionality offered by the system. Consistent monitoring is key to preventing unexpected outages.

Integration with Existing Infrastructure

A key consideration when adopting any new automation tool is its ability to integrate with existing infrastructure. Winspirit is designed to be highly interoperable, supporting a wide range of operating systems, databases, and applications. It can seamlessly integrate with popular virtualization platforms, cloud services, and DevOps tools. This allows organizations to leverage their existing investments and avoid the need for costly and disruptive migrations. The platform offers APIs and scripting interfaces, enabling developers to create custom integrations tailored to their specific requirements. The adaptability is a major advantage, allowing organizations to integrate winspirit into their existing workflows without significant modifications.

The flexibility of the integration capabilities extends to security protocols. Winspirit supports secure communication channels and authentication mechanisms, ensuring that sensitive data remains protected. It also integrates with identity management systems, allowing administrators to control access to automation resources based on user roles and permissions. This robust security framework is essential for protecting critical systems and data.

Beyond Automation: Extending Capabilities with Custom Scripts and Plugins

While winspirit provides a comprehensive set of built-in features, its true power lies in its extensibility. The platform allows users to create custom scripts and plugins to extend its capabilities beyond the standard functionality. This is particularly useful for automating tasks that are unique to a specific organization or application. Developers can leverage the platform’s scripting language and APIs to create custom modules that integrate seamlessly with the existing automation framework. The possibilities are virtually limitless, allowing organizations to tailor winspirit to their exact needs. This adaptability ensures that the platform remains a valuable asset as their requirements evolve.

Furthermore, a growing community of users is actively developing and sharing plugins, expanding the platform’s functionality even further. This collaborative approach fosters innovation and accelerates the development of new automation solutions. By leveraging the collective knowledge and expertise of the community, organizations can benefit from a constantly evolving ecosystem of tools and resources. This collaborative spirit is a key differentiator, setting winspirit apart from other automation solutions.

Comments are closed.